Abstract

Water temperature. salinity. seagrass coverage. organic matter content in the soil and soil texture play an important role in the distribution of bivalves. The present study was carried out to determine whether these parameters significantly affect the abundance of three commercially important bivalve species viz. Gofrarium_rumidum ,Jarcia hiantina arid Marcia opima in the Puttalam lagoon and Dutch bay. The abundance of ...
